Material Selection: The Heart of the Budget
The choice of material dictates both the aesthetic and financial scope of your project. For the absolute lowest cost, consider compacted gravel or decomposed granite, which offer excellent drainage and a rustic charm. If you desire a more refined look without the price of hardwood, composite decking boards made from recycled materials provide the appearance of wood with significantly reduced maintenance needs.

Staging on a Shoestring
Furniture is where many budgets get stretched, but comfortable seating is essential for enjoying your new space. Look for second-hand patio sets at garage sales or online marketplaces, or repaint an old wrought iron set for a fresh look. Adding weatherproof cushions can dramatically increase comfort for a fraction of the cost of new furniture.

| Material | Estimated Cost per Sq Ft | Lifespan |
|---|---|---|
| Gravel/Decomposed Granite | $3 - $6 | 2-3 Years |
| Concrete Pavers | $8 - $20 | 15-20 Years |
| Composite Decking | $10 - $15 | 25+ Years |
